Yesterday, after church I got to go do a little deer hunting. I hunted a great looking spot on the edge of some real thick hardwoods and a big CRP field that meets a huge corn field. I have been deer hunting quite a bit this year but I haven’t seen a lot of deer. I am in a rut, no pun intended. Yesterday was no different, I didn’t see the first deer. I saw a bunch of pick-up trucks but no deer. I know that I am hunting a great spot from all the sign I am seeing, it is wore out with whitetail sign. I am making sure to take all the steps for scent control and hunting with the wind in my favor it has just been tough for me seeing whitetails this year. I am frustrated but will not give up on this spot. Hopefully my luck will change, it just takes one hunt to score on one of those big bucks and change the whole deer season.

Last week my boys and I were outside and we saw some coyotes way down in the back of our pasture, so I went and got my video camera and filmed them.I was planning on going to Cabelas and getting a predator call and filming myself calling them in and shooting them. My boys like to play outside and it kind of freaks me out having coyotes so close by. Then yesterday as was was getting ready for church and my wife says there is a coyote in the front yard. So I made a b-line to my deer rifle and got some shells and snuck 0ut the back door and eased around the front of the house. And about the time I saw him he saw me and decided it was time to skeedaddle but it was to late. Not to brag but I was an expert marksman in the Army and a moving coyote at 70 yards was no problem. My 7mm short mag did a number on him! It was the first time I have ever been hunting in my Sunday best.
